Mission
Doctors of the World Spain (Médicos del Mundo / MdM-E) is a humanitarian organization that cares for the most vulnerable populations, victims of armed conflicts, natural disasters, etc., and documents the obstacles encountered in accessing healthcare. In Spain and internationally in 18 other countries, our actions aim to facilitate access to the healthcare system, but we also act beyond healthcare by denouncing violations of dignity and human rights and fighting to improve the situation of vulnerable populations.
MdM Spain has been present in Burkina Faso since 2002 and currently carries out projects in four regions: Sahel, Centre-Nord, Centre and Haut-Bassins.
